Honey Garlic Chicken and Shrimp Fried Rice

A delicious, high-protein Honey Garlic Chicken and Shrimp Fried Rice that is better than takeout.

Ingredients

1 lb chicken breast, cut into bite-size pieces

1/2 lb shrimp, peeled and deveined

3 cups cooked rice

2 eggs, scrambled

2 tbsp oil

1 tbsp butter

2 cloves garlic, minced

Salt to taste

Black pepper to taste

1 tsp garlic powder

1/2 tsp paprika

1/4 cup soy sauce

2 tbsp honey

1 tbsp brown sugar

1 tbsp teriyaki sauce

1 tbsp oyster sauce

1 tsp sesame oil

1 tsp cornstarch

1 tbsp water

Instructions

1.Season chicken with salt, black pepper, garlic powder, and paprika.

2.Heat oil in a skillet and cook chicken until golden.

3.Add butter and shrimp; cook until shrimp are pink.

4.Stir in garlic.

5.Whisk soy sauce, honey, brown sugar, teriyaki, oyster sauce, sesame oil, cornstarch, and water.

6.Pour sauce into skillet and simmer until thick.

7.In another skillet, heat rice with eggs until warm and crispy.

8.Serve chicken and shrimp over fried rice.

Notes

Use day-old rice for best texture. Add vegetables like peas or carrots for extra nutrition.
